BGM — Beginning of Message / Doc Type
EDIFACT segment
📘
Identifies the document itself: its type (order, invoice, despatch advice...), its number, and the purpose of the message (original, cancellation, change).
Example
BGM+220+PO-2026-0042+9'
Data Elements
| Pos. | Description |
|---|---|
01 | Document Name Code |
02 | Document Number |
03 | Message Function Code |

Watch out
The third element matters: 9 means original, 1 cancellation, 4 change. A wrong value here can create duplicate orders downstream.
